30 Responsibilities Under intermittent supervision is accountable for (a) the preparation of stores requisitions and review of work order closings and (b) reviewing daily labor reports for accuracy.
Has regular contact with the public.
Typical Activities - Has contact with other departments, contractors, public authorities, other utilities and customers for the exchange of information, to advise them of the activity of the department or to arrange for the delivery of materials to work areas.
Operates the two-way radio, notes crew locations and relays information to crews.
Prepares the accompanying stores requisitions and reviews work, service, transformer, etc.
orders; when field completed.
Prepares reports and maintains log relating to work order progress.
Reviews daily labor reports and crew sheets for accuracy.
Maintains record of overtime and lost time hours.
Reviews running records for department vehicles.
Maintains stock of tools and equipment and prepares related reports and records.
Takes periodic inventories.
Maintains departmental files.
Types correspondence, reports, records, etc.
Operates office equipment such as typewriters, calculating and duplicating machines.
Does other related or less skilled work as required.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
